Where they cluster

Consumer goods occupiers in Shenzhen typically anchor in Luohu. Banking, trade, professional services, retail HQs.

What they pay

Class A rent in Shenzhen runs 290 CNY/sqft ($45 USD) on a 5-year lease with 10 months free. Prime submarkets sit at or modestly above the city index.

Spec and fit-out

Typical consumer goods fit-out targets high-end specification at $3400–5000/sqft. Branded reception, full client-facing programming, premium furniture, and specialist AV are standard.

Headcount sizing

Plan around 180 sqft per seat blended (workstation + circulation + amenity). A 100-headcount consumer office in Shenzhen typically targets 18,000 sqft of leasable area.

Talent angle

Brand, merchandising, and digital teams gravitate to creative-class submarkets with strong adjacent retail and hospitality. Deep tech, hardware engineering, and consumer electronics talent. Strong feed from Shenzhen University, Southern University of Science and Technology, and proximity to Hong Kong universities. Mandarin and Cantonese operating environment.

Tax and lease context

Headline corporate tax: 25%. Net leases. 5-7 year terms standard. Free rent of 8-15 months and TI of CNY 1,000-2,000/sqm typical on a 5-year deal. Concession environment is rich.
